New Call of Duty: Blackness Ops Cold War Zombies Map Coming Earlier Than Expected
In a surprise move, Treyarch is not just revealing the adjacent Call of Duty: Black Ops Cold War Zombies map, but is releasing it early.
Call of Duty: Black Ops Cold War is announcing details surrounding its latest Zombies map. Non only is new information being released ahead of schedule, only the Call of Duty: Black Ops Common cold Warmap itself will be playable much earlier than expected.
Programmer Treyarch'due south sixth entry in itsBlack Opsseries officially launched on November 13. The game has since received mixed reviews, with some praising its innovative campaign while others are critical of multiplayer's lack of depth. While those directly involved withBlack Ops Cold State of war take been posting tidbits of information the by few days, about players were expecting big reveals to come up on 115 Solar day.
Detailed in a web log on Treyarch's official website, the post confirms when and where the Dark Aether storyline will continue next. After destroying the "Projekt Endstation" site in the first map Die Maschine, players are heading adjacent to the latest Dark Aether outbreak site: Outpost 25, improve known as "Firebase Z." This confirms the longstanding rumors ofCall of Duty: Blackness Ops Cold War Zombies DLC Map 1 being the Vietnamese base. Originally set to release with the beginning of Season Ii, the game's developers accept advanced the map's launch by several weeks.
Treyarch is promising more details of the new location for 115 Day, January fifteen, forth with additional updates to wait when the map launches. In addition to Firebase Z beingness completely costless for all players (a significant deviation from previousBlack Ops titles),Call of Duty: Black Ops Cold War kicks off its Zombies free access calendar week today. This means players who accept withal to buy the base game tin get their easily on the storiedCall of Duty mode without any real investment.
While its unclear exactly what the reasoning is behind Treyarch contempo charitable disposition, it likely could exist due to frequent leaks, glitches, or both. Before and even after its integration withPhone call of Duty: Warzone,Blackness Ops Common cold War has suffered from numerous gameplay bugs. In add-on to multiplayer anteroom and major hit detection issues, the Zombies mode didn't fifty-fifty accept a split-screen feature until recently. Once the expected characteristic was added, many fans complained that the way was broken or otherwise nigh unplayable. The early and costless Zombies content could certainly be Treyarch'south way of apologizing.
